How they compare
Uruguay currently reports 110.6% against 99.0% in WB: Post-demographic Dividend, a difference of 11.6%.
That makes Uruguay's figure about 1.1 times WB: Post-demographic Dividend's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1999 it was WB: Post-demographic Dividend ahead.
Uruguay ranks 18th and WB: Post-demographic Dividend ranks 18th of 186 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Uruguay averaged higher in 1 and WB: Post-demographic Dividend in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Uruguay | WB: Post-demographic Dividend |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 88.6% | 91.5% | 2.9% | WB: Post-demographic Dividend |
| 2000s | 93.8% | 94.4% | 0.6% | WB: Post-demographic Dividend |
| 2020s | 110.7% | 100.6% | 10.1% | Uruguay |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
